ATHENS, Ga. – Jacksonville State finished with a three-day total of 955 to post a Top 20 finish at the NCAA Women’s Golf East Regional at the University of Georgia Golf Course.

Jacksonville State, which earned its fourth straight NCAA Regional appearance after winning the Ohio Valley Conference Championship last month, shot rounds of 327-315-313.

Second-seeded Florida held off top-seeded Duke to claim a one-stroke victory over the three-time defending National Champions. Georgia turned the low team loop of the day on Saturday, a 290, and finished third at 889. Rounding out the top-eight teams advancing to the NCAA Championships were Auburn at 894, Virginia at 898, South Carolina and Wake Forest both at 899 and Furman at 900.

Senior Mercedes Huarte shot her second straight round of 75 on Saturday to post a three round total of 226 to tie for 27th place to lead the Gamecocks.

Freshman Laura Cutler also shot a 75 and carded a 54-hole score of 240, while Ashley Cox finished her second NCAA event with a 243. Portia Abbott carded a 246 and Alexandra Espinosa turned in a 260.
